Job Description
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: Must be at least 14 years old. Six months experience in recreational activities is desired. Skill to learn MCCS policies, rules and regulations involving the area, and ability to communicate orally and in writing. Knowledge of basic mathematics. This is a mixed position where the incumbent must be able to lift and carry objects up to 45lbs independently and objects over 45lbs with assistance. Must be able to obtain certifications in standard first aid, CPR, and AED. Must be able to accommodate a flexible work schedule to include nights, weekends, and holidays. Must be able to obtain and maintain a National Agency Check with Inquiries and State Criminal History Repository Check (Tier 1) with Childcare background checks which are required for positions that involve working with children under the age of 18.
